当前位置: 首页 > 专利查询>大连大学专利>正文

一种微纳卫星多目标优化资源分配方法组成比例

技术编号:34371591 阅读:25 留言:0更新日期:2022-07-31 11:25
本发明专利技术公开了一种微纳卫星多目标优化资源分配方法,包括:通过微纳卫星资源分配问题的目标函数,确定优化目标为频谱效率与能量效率:假设搜索空间维数表示卫星通信网络中设备的数量,粒子群算法中各粒子表示波束资源分配情况,将波束资源分配的优化目标转化为获取粒子群算法的目标函数;对波束采用Tent混沌映射进行初始化,以确保各波束资源分配的均匀性;在粒子群算法中加入了正余弦思想,更新波束的速度和位置;通过多样性函数定期判断目标群体的状态,运用Tent混沌映射对各波束的资源分配情况进行混沌填充操作。本发明专利技术使得各波束资源初始分配均匀,提高了微纳卫星资源分配的效率,优化了系统性能。优化了系统性能。优化了系统性能。

【技术实现步骤摘要】
一种微纳卫星多目标优化资源分配方法


[0001]本专利技术涉及微纳卫星通信资源分配
,具体涉及一种微纳卫星多目标优化资源分配方法。

技术介绍

[0002]卫星通信网络由于其具有覆盖广、部署快、不受地面情况影响的优点,已经被用于多个商用系统,在空天互联网和5G网络中也是研究热点之一。随着卫星通信的快速发展,多点波束以高增益的点波束覆盖和频分复用的优势,在卫星通信系统中获得了广泛应用。而在多波束卫星通信系统中,由于星上信道、功率资源的严格制约,所以使用合适的资源分配方法尤为重要。近年来,传统资源分配算法是基于单目标的资源优化,已逐渐不能满足用户的需求,于是多目标优化的资源分配方法成为了备受关注的热点。
[0003]国内外学者对卫星系统资源分配方法的研究已经有很多,如运用各种启发式算法、采用拉格朗日对偶理论等。但现有方法也存在一些缺陷,如未考虑频信道干扰、收敛速度较慢、未兼顾能量效率和频谱效率等。

技术实现思路

[0004]本专利技术的目的在于,提供一种微纳卫星多目标优化资源分配方法,其使得各波束资源初始分配均匀,提高了微纳卫星资源分配的效率,优化了系统性能。
[0005]为实现上述目的,本申请提出一种微纳卫星多目标优化资源分配方法,包括:
[0006]通过微纳卫星资源分配问题的目标函数,确定优化目标为频谱效率与能量效率:假设搜索空间维数表示卫星通信网络中设备的数量,粒子群算法中各粒子表示波束资源分配情况,将波束资源分配的优化目标转化为获取粒子群算法的目标函数;
[0007]对波束采用Tent混沌映射进行初始化,以确保各波束资源分配的均匀性;
[0008]在粒子群算法中加入了正余弦思想,更新波束的速度和位置;
[0009]通过多样性函数定期判断目标群体的状态,运用Tent混沌映射对各波束的资源分配情况进行混沌填充操作。
[0010]进一步的,微纳卫星资源分配问题的目标函数设计如下:假设多波束卫星系统在理想状态下,用户能够达到最大速率则时刻t
j
系统的能量效率为:
[0011][0012]其中,用户编号是时间t
j
系统中的下行用户总数,为系统总的下行吞吐量,b=1,2,

,M
b
代表波束数目编号,表示每波束的功率,P
O
为静态
电路消耗功率;
[0013]系统的频谱效率表示为:
[0014][0015]B为卫星系统总带宽,将多波束卫星系统资源分配问题的优化目标表示为:
[0016][0017][0018][0019][0020][0021]本专利技术优化的是T时间段系统累计性能;其中,Γ1为最大化总累计频谱效率,Γ2为最大化总累计能量效率,任意时刻t
j
下,系统总的分配功率、每波束的功率应不高于系统总功率门限和单波束功率门限P
totmax
;此外,任意时刻系统总的吞吐量满足最小需求速率要求
[0022]进一步的,所述粒子群算法的目标函数F
j
由所述频谱效率能量效率归一化处理后的加权和组成;首先,为了使两个指标对总的目标函数公平影响,将频谱效率能量效率都归一化到[0,1];接着,根据优化目标的侧重对各指标变量赋予相应的权重,再通过加权和求得优化目标F
j

[0023][0024]其中a1、a2为两个指标的归一化参数,ω1、ω2为权重参数,惩罚值μ(μ>0)解释为代价,当约束溢出时,通过惩罚值μ给予一定比例的惩罚。
[0025]进一步的,所述Tent混沌映射设计如下:先利用Tent映射关系将波束变量映射到混沌变量空间内,然后再将产生的混沌变量通过线性变换映射到需要优化的解空间内,Tent映射具体表达式如下:
[0026][0027]其中,x
k
表示第k个混沌波束资源数量。
[0028]进一步的,在粒子群算法中加入了正余弦思想,更新波束的速度和位置,具体为:
假设搜索空间为d维,资源总数为N,那么第t次迭代过程中第i个目标波束的位置更新公式为:
[0029][0030]其中X
id
(t)表示第t次迭代中第i个目标波束在第d维上的位置;R2、R3、R4为随机数,其中R2∈[0,2π],R3∈[0,2],R4∈[0,1];P*
d
为当前最优目标波束在d维上的位置,即粒子群算法中的Gbest;R1为转换参数,用于平衡算法的全局探索和局部开发,其公式如下:
[0031][0032]其中a为常数,t、N分别为当前迭代代数和最大迭代次数;R1控制了第i个目标波束在下一次迭代中移动到的位置区域,R2控制了第i个目标波束靠近或远离最优目标波束的移动距离,R3为目标波束位置的随机权重,控制目标波束位置对当前位置的影响力,R4为切换概率,即使用正弦操作还是余弦操作;当正弦函数R1sin(R2)或余弦函数R1cos(R2)的取值范围在(1,2]或[

2,

1)之间时,为全局搜索阶段;当正弦函数R1sin(R2)或余弦函数R1cos(R2)的取值范围在[

1,1]之间时,为局部开采阶段。
[0033]更进一步的,通过多样性函数定期判断目标群体的状态,具体为:利用目标波束与群体内其他目标波束之间的平均Hamming距离来量化群体多样性,所述平均Hamming距离如式(12),(13)所示:
[0034][0035][0036]其中,NP表示目标波束总量,H(a
i
,b
j
)表示多波束卫星通信系统中两个目标之间的汉明距离,D表示目标维度,a
ik
、b
ik
分别表示目标a
i
、b
i
在k维空间的位置;
[0037]在设置的时间间隔内,利用平均Hamming距离测量式对群体多样性进行测量,如果目标波束多样性低于给定的阈值,表示目标数量要么达到最大迭代次数,要么进入局部最优的搜索陷阱,此时需要执行混沌填充操作。
[0038]更进一步的,所述运用Tent混沌映射对各波束的资源分配情况进行混沌填充操作,具体为:
[0039]首先,将各目标波束按适应度函数值进行排序,然后去除50%适应度较低的目标波束;
[0040]若目标群体正进入早熟收敛阶段,此时通过Tent混沌映射引进新目标波束,替代去除50%的目标波束进行后续迭代。
[0041]本专利技术采用的以上技术方案,与现有技术相比,具有的优点是:
[0042](1)混沌具有强随机性、非周期性等优点,利用混沌序列对波束进行初始化,并将
产生的混沌变量通过线性变换映射到需要优化的解空间,使得各波束资源初始分配均匀。
[0043](2)在标准粒子群算法中加入了正余弦算法,提高寻优速度的同时,提高了微纳卫星资源分配的效率。
[00本文档来自技高网
...

【技术保护点】

【技术特征摘要】
1.一种微纳卫星多目标优化资源分配方法,其特征在于,包括:通过微纳卫星资源分配问题的目标函数,确定优化目标为频谱效率与能量效率:假设搜索空间维数表示卫星通信网络中设备的数量,粒子群算法中各粒子表示波束资源分配情况,将波束资源分配的优化目标转化为获取粒子群算法的目标函数;对波束采用Tent混沌映射进行初始化,以确保各波束资源分配的均匀性;在粒子群算法中加入了正余弦思想,更新波束的速度和位置;通过多样性函数定期判断目标群体的状态,运用Tent混沌映射对各波束的资源分配情况进行混沌填充操作。2.根据权利要求1所述一种微纳卫星多目标优化资源分配方法,其特征在于,微纳卫星资源分配问题的目标函数设计如下:假设多波束卫星系统在理想状态下,用户能够达到最大速率则时刻t
j
系统的能量效率为:其中,用户编号其中,用户编号是时间t
j
系统中的下行用户总数,为系统总的下行吞吐量,b=1,2,

,M
b
代表波束数目编号,表示每波束的功率,P
O
为静态电路消耗功率;系统的频谱效率表示为:B为卫星系统总带宽,将多波束卫星系统资源分配问题的优化目标表示为:B为卫星系统总带宽,将多波束卫星系统资源分配问题的优化目标表示为:B为卫星系统总带宽,将多波束卫星系统资源分配问题的优化目标表示为:B为卫星系统总带宽,将多波束卫星系统资源分配问题的优化目标表示为:B为卫星系统总带宽,将多波束卫星系统资源分配问题的优化目标表示为:本发明优化的是T时间段系统累计性能;其中,Γ1为最大化总累计频谱效率,Γ2为最大化总累计能量效率,任意时刻t
j
下,系统总的分配功率、每波束的功率不高于系统总功率门限和单波束功率门限P
totmax
;此外,任意时刻系统总的吞吐量满足最小需求速率要求
3.根据权利要求2所述一种微纳卫星多目标优化资源分配方法,其特征在于,所述粒子群算法的目标函数F
j
由所述频谱效率能量效率归一化处理后的加权和组成;首先,为了使两个指标对总的目标函数公平影响,将频谱效率能量效率都归一化到[0,1];接着,根据优化目标的侧重对各指标变量赋予相应的权重,再通过加权和求得优化目标F
j
:其中a1、a2为两个指标的归一化参数,ω1、ω2为权重参数,惩罚值μ解释为代价,当约束溢出时,通过惩罚值μ给予一定比例的惩罚。4.根据权利要求1所述一种微纳卫星多目标优化资源分配方法,其特征在于,所述Tent混沌映射设计如下:先利用Tent映射关系将波束变量映射到混沌变量空间内,然后再将产生的混沌变量通过线性变换映射到需要优化的解空间内,T...

【专利技术属性】
技术研发人员:张然陈成锴孙明晨丁元明杨阳
申请(专利权)人:大连大学
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1